What Counts as Video Gear for Influencers?

Video gear for influencers refers to the complete toolkit used to capture, light, record, and edit short-form video content for social platforms. For fashion creators, this gear is specifically chosen to make clothing textures, colors, and silhouettes look their best on camera.

The core categories include:

  • Camera or smartphone — your primary image capture deviceLens and optics — determines sharpness, depth, and framingLighting — controls mood, color accuracy, and shadow detailAudio equipment — microphones for voiceovers, ASMR styling, and interviewsStabilization — tripods, gimbals, and mounts for smooth motionBackground and styling tools — backdrops, garment racks, and mirrorsEditing hardware and software — for post-production polish

Essential Video Gear for Influencers in 2026

1. Camera or Smartphone

The newest flagship smartphones, including the iPhone 16 Pro Max, Samsung Galaxy S25 Ultra, and Google Pixel 9 Pro, shoot stunning 4K HDR video that rivals dedicated cameras. For dedicated shooters, the Sony ZV-E10 II, Canon R50 V, and Fujifilm X-S20 remain top picks for fashion content thanks to their flip screens and color science.

2. Lighting Setup

Lighting is the single most impactful upgrade. A two-point softbox kit, ring light, or compact LED panel like the Aputure Amaran 60d brings out true fabric colors and eliminates unflattering shadows. For outdoor shoots, a portable reflector is essential for managing midday sun.

3. Tripod and Gimbal

Stability separates amateur content from professional work. A reliable tripod is non-negotiable for outfit transitions, while a 3-axis gimbal like the DJI RS 4 Mini unlocks dynamic walk-and-talk styling videos.

4. Microphone

Clear audio is often overlooked. Lavalier mics such as the Rode Wireless GO III or Hollyland Lark M2 are perfect for talking-head fashion commentary and styling voiceovers.

5. Background and Backdrop

A clean backdrop — whether a neutral wall, paper roll, or curated closet shot — keeps viewer focus on the clothing. Portable backdrop stands make location shoots effortless.

How to Choose the Right Video Gear for Your Platform

For TikTok

TikTok thrives on authentic, fast-paced content. You do not need a cinema camera — a smartphone with good low-light performance and a small ring light is often enough. Vertical filming at 9:16 and 30fps is standard.

For Instagram Reels

Reels reward polished aesthetics, so prioritize good lighting and color-accurate footage. Filming at 60fps enables smoother slow-motion outfit transitions.

For YouTube Shorts

Shorts benefit from the highest production value since viewers often come from long-form subscribers. Use a dedicated camera, external mic, and proper lighting for best results.

Tips and Strategies to Maximize Your Video Gear

  • Match resolution to platform — 1080p is sufficient for most short-form content and saves storageShoot in log or flat profiles — gives you more flexibility when color grading fashion footageUse color-calibrated monitors — your edited video must match the actual outfit colorLay outfits flat before filming — wrinkled fabric kills engagementFilm B-roll early in the day — natural window light is free and flatteringInvest in storage — fashion videos with multiple takes eat disk space quickly

Do I need an expensive camera to be a successful fashion influencer?

No. Many successful fashion influencers shoot exclusively on flagship smartphones, especially when combined with good lighting and a tripod. Modern phones deliver 4K HDR video with accurate color, which is more than enough for TikTok, Instagram Reels, and YouTube Shorts. Upgrading to a dedicated camera makes sense once you start earning brand deals or shooting sponsored lookbooks.

What lighting do fashion influencers use?

Most fashion influencers use diffused LED panels, softbox kits, or large ring lights to achieve even, flattering light that renders fabric colors accurately. For outdoor shoots, a portable reflector helps balance harsh sunlight and eliminate shadows on clothing.

How much should I spend on video gear for influencers?

Beginners can start with around $400 to $700 for a complete kit consisting of a smartphone, ring light, tripod, and wireless mic. Mid-tier creators typically invest $1,500 to $3,000, while professional creators building a home studio may spend $5,000 or more.
